About N-[1-(3H-imidazo[4,5-c]pyridin-2-yl)piperidin-4-yl]-5-methylpyridine-2-carboxamide
N-[1-(3H-imidazo[4,5-c]pyridin-2-yl)piperidin-4-yl]-5-methylpyridine-2-carboxamide (PubChem CID 164539238) has the molecular formula C18H20N6O
and a molecular weight of 336.40 g/mol. Its IUPAC name is N-[1-(3H-imidazo[4,5-c]pyridin-2-yl)piperidin-4-yl]-5-methylpyridine-2-carboxamide.

What is the SMILES notation for N-[1-(3H-imidazo[4,5-c]pyridin-2-yl)piperidin-4-yl]-5-methylpyridine-2-carboxamide?
The canonical SMILES for N-[1-(3H-imidazo[4,5-c]pyridin-2-yl)piperidin-4-yl]-5-methylpyridine-2-carboxamide is Cc1ccc(C(=O)NC2CCN(c3nc4ccncc4[nH]3)CC2)nc1.
What is the InChIKey of N-[1-(3H-imidazo[4,5-c]pyridin-2-yl)piperidin-4-yl]-5-methylpyridine-2-carboxamide?
The InChIKey is ZXNOXMWBRMVNEI-UHFFFAOYSA-N. The full InChI is InChI=1S/C18H20N6O/c1-12-2-3-15(20-10-12)17(25)21-13-5-8-24(9-6-13)18-22-14-4-7-19-11-16(14)23-18/h2-4,7,10-11,13H,5-6,8-9H2,1H3,(H,21,25)(H,22,23).
What are the key properties of N-[1-(3H-imidazo[4,5-c]pyridin-2-yl)piperidin-4-yl]-5-methylpyridine-2-carboxamide?
N-[1-(3H-imidazo[4,5-c]pyridin-2-yl)piperidin-4-yl]-5-methylpyridine-2-carboxamide has a molecular weight of 336.40 g/mol, XLogP of 2.06, 3 rotatable bonds, 2 hydrogen bond donors, and 5 hydrogen bond acceptors.
